Samsung's The Family Hub 2016


by Heidrick's Appliance





The smart refrigerators with internet-connected apps have been introduced to CES for the past 5 years.  However, at this year’s convention, Samsung introduced a new and improved smart-fridge; they gave it a facelift.

Samsung’s new Family Hub features an extraordinary 21.5 inch high-definition touchscreen that firs most of the right-hand door. This gadget can show the weather, play music, display calendars that belong to different family members, show photos and play recipe videos. Think that’s impressive? Those features are just the tip of the iceberg.





The Family Hub will also be able to help you order groceries online. Samsung is in the process of launching a demo with FreshDirect and Shop-Rite apps to get this feature up and running. They are currently working on getting other vendors to join. Yet another impressive feature is on the inside. Three cameras were included to take pictures of the content every time the doors are shut. In addition, expiration dates can be assigned to each of the item, if being scrupulous about your food is not your strong suit. Besides, there aren’t any more excuses to forget something on your grocery list. You can now take a peek at what’s left in the fridge while at the grocery store.




It’s pretty clear that Samsung is trying to make everyday tasks more efficient and feasible through technology. If this is the refrigerator for you, expect it to hit the market by spring 2016!
